Precision Begins With Proportion
Proportion is the foundation of craftsmanship. A well-crafted band feels balanced from every angle, with consistent width, even spacing, and a silhouette that holds its shape through years of wear.
In wedding bands for women, proportion determines both comfort and visual harmony. A band that is too thin can feel insubstantial, while one that is too wide can overwhelm the hand. The most refined designs strike a careful balance, allowing the ring to feel present without feeling heavy.

Metal Finish Shapes the Experience
Metal plays a significant role in how a wedding band feels. A high polish finish creates a smooth surface that reflects light subtly and wears comfortably against the skin. Matte or brushed finishes offer a different expression, but they require equal discipline to execute well.

Comfort Is Part of Craft
A wedding band should feel natural the moment it is worn. Comfort fit interiors, thoughtful edge shaping, and proper weight distribution all contribute to that experience.
This is especially important for ladies wedding bands intended for everyday wear. A ring that looks refined but feels uncomfortable quickly loses its appeal. Craftsmanship ensures that beauty and wearability are never at odds.
